CURC Welcomes New Members IBEW and ClearPath Action

October 21, 2016

CURC is pleased to report the addition of two new members - the International Brotherhood of Electric Workers (IBEW) and ClearPath Action.

The International Brotherhood of Electrical Workers represents 725,000 active members and retirees who work in a wide variety of fields, including utilities, construction, telecommunications, broadcasting, manufacturing, railroads and government.  The IBEW has members in both the United States and Canada and stands out among the American unions in the AFL-CIO because it is among the largest and has members in a wide array of skilled occupations.  IBEW has long supported a national energy policy that addresses climate change while promoting baseload power, and has been a supporter of the CCUS Act (S. 3179) and carbon capture technologies more broadly to promote further investment in coal-fired generation.

ClearPath Action is a 501(c)4 nonprofit organization with the mission to accelerate conservative clean energy solutions by focusing on lowering barriers for affordable and reliable baseload clean power: clean coal, nuclear, natural gas, and hydropower; and on driving breakthrough energy innovation. Operationally, the organization works with policymakers to help them understand how policy may impact their districts and America's economic competitiveness and energy security.
